Orchestrates the complete 7-stage PRISMA 2020 systematic literature review pipeline. Acts as the conductor, delegating to specialized agents (I1, I2, I3) while managing checkpoints and ensuring human approval at critical decision points.
Stage 1: Research Domain Setup → config.yaml, project initialization
Stage 2: Query Strategy → Boolean search strings, database selection
Stage 3: Paper Retrieval → I1-paper-retrieval-agent
Stage 4: Deduplication → 02_deduplicate.py
Stage 5: PRISMA Screening → I2-screening-assistant (Groq LLM)
Stage 6: PDF Download + RAG → I3-rag-builder

| Stage | Task | Recommended Provider | Cost/100 papers | |-------|------|---------------------|-----------------| | 5 | PRISMA Screening | Groq (llama-3.3-70b) | $0.01 | | 6 | RAG Queries | Groq (llama-3.3-70b) | $0.02 | | - | Fallback | Claude Haiku | $0.15 |
Total cost for 500-paper systematic review: ~$0.07 (vs $7.50 with Claude only)

| Mode | DB Fetch Time | Total Pipeline | |------|--------------|----------------| | Sequential | ~90 min | ~4-6 hours | | Teams (3 parallel) | ~30 min | ~2.5-4 hours |
Teams mode spawns N independent sessions. Each session consumes separate API tokens. For budget-conscious runs, sequential mode is recommended.
